Abstract: Toronto - An agreement between Canada Border Services Agency (CBSA) and the Canadian Red Cross (CRC), announced last week to much government fanfare, is being described by opponents of Canadas indefinite immigration detention regime as political spin and not a new development.
On July 27, Minister of Public Safety and Emergency Preparedness Ralph Goodale announced the signing of a two-year, $1.14 million contract between the CBSA and the CRC, for the purpose of monitoring immigration deten... To read the full release go to http://www.sources.com/Releases/NR2886.htm
